What is Quizizz?

Quizizz is a fun multiplayer quiz game that allows students to practice content together. Students can play quizzes assigned by their teachers or compete globally on live games. What is set-up like?

The teacher creates an account at quizziz.com (may use Google account). Teachers can find and edit an existing quiz or create one of their own from scratch. Students download the Quizizz app and are able to adjust settings for their app (including “Read Aloud”). If the quiz is played live, the teacher starts it. You can customize game play by turning on or off advanced settings like question shuffle, show answers, timer, leaderboard, and Power-ups. Power-ups are awarded sparatically and benefit the players like getting a second chance, unlimited time or 2x the points. Power ups will not work with games of 50+ players. A quiz can also be assigned as homework to be completed by the student at any time. When any game is started, a game pin is generated. Students use the game pin to join the game. Students can join through an app, or on the web.

There are three game modes: classic, team, and test. In team mode, students work individually, but scores are combined to make winning a team effort. Test mode removes the gaming aspects of the quiz and could be used to deliver a multiple choice style assessment. Test mode requires students to login.

What type of data feedback is available?

Students compete against the class. They earn points by answering questions correctly and quickly. Real time data is collected by the teacher. At the end of the game you get a report that is archived in your account.
